In a test, a student either guesses or copies or knows the answer to a multiple choice question with four choices having one correct answer. The probability that he guesses the answer is `1/3` and the probability that he copies it is ` 1/12` . the probability that his answer is correct given that he copied it is `1/6` the probability that he knew the answer, given that he has correctly answered it, is

A

`6/7`

B

`15/49`

C

`7/12`

D

`10/13`

In a test a candidate may have answered a question in 3 ways. The question is a multiple choice question with 4 choices one of which is the correct answer. He might have guessed the answer for which the probability is 1/3. He might have copied the answer for which the probability is 1/6. He might have known the answer. If he copied the answer the probability that his answer is correct is 1/8. Find the probability that he knew the answer given that he correctly answerd it.
